How did the ming dynasty census aichent china?

In 1370, the first census was made, which aimed not only at taking all objects into account, but also at determining the size of the property of each yard.

Explanation:

  • Depending on the property, the yards were taxed with land tax and labor taxes so that their size depended on the amount of land, workers, property on a separate farm.
  • In 1381, changes were made to this system to simplify the tax collection and customs clearance process.
  • Yards are grouped into groups of 10 (chia), with every 10 chia constituted by Lee.
  • These yards were bound by mutual responsibility in paying taxes and public dues. So Lee was 110 households: 100 - peasant and 10 - older.

In 100 to 150 words, compare and contrast the U.S. Revolution and the South American Revolution.
arlik [135]

Answer:

    The U.S. Revolution and the South American Revolution were both fought between citizens (people who fought for independence) and colonizers (the mother country). The citizens of the colonized areas fought against high taxes. They also wanted political change and, as a result, created Republics. However, the Patriots (Americans) were more united and therefore, the Latin Revolution took twice as long. Furthermore, there was class division in South America.
